New Product Introduction (NPI) is Honeywell’s organizational link between Integrated Supply Chain and the product development functions of Engineering, Program Management, and the Strategic Business Units.
Become part of an engineering team that is defining the future of Honeywell aircraft products. As an Engineering Support Specialist here at Honeywell, you will provide technical support and expertise to the Advance Manufacturing Engineering team, ensuring smooth product development, utilizing Honeywell SAP processes. You will play a critical role in optimizing engineering workflows and driving efficiency through the effective use of SAP, directly contributing to the success of our NPI engineering team and the overall Honeywell Aerospace Technologies business enabling delivery of new products to our customers.
The current specific opportunity is in the mechanical aerospace component design market space. This position requires on-site presence at the HON facility located in Torrance, CA.
In this role, you will directly contribute towards the success of the engineering design and manufacturing operations by providing critical technical support that includes (but not limited to):
1. Production demand management
2. Parts inventory management
3. Work order management
4. Production parts tracking through proper SAP updates (from incoming to factory floor to shipping)
5. Documenting product completion status through all phases of manufacturing
In this role, you are also expected to coll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ify and implement process improvements, ensuring the effective use of SAP in engineering operations.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
+ Provide technical support and expertise to the engineering team in the use of SAP systems and processes
+ Manage and provide status on engineering production parts inventory on factory floor
+ Manage and provide status on product shipping and receiving related to NPI engineering needs and LRU’s
+ Manage and provide status on elements across the IPDS process phases, such as APQP, First Article Inspections, Manufacturing Readiness.
+ Directly handle hardware movement of NPI build units across the site
+ Troubleshoot and resolve SAP-related issues, ensuring the smooth operation of engineering workflows within the IPDS process and Development phases.
+ Optimize engineering processes and workflows through the effective use of SAP
+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ify and implement process improvements

Honeywell Aerospace Technologies (AT) products and services are found on virtually every commercial, defense, and space aircraft in the world. We build aircraft engines, cockpit and cabin electronics, wireless connectivity systems, mechanical components and more, and connect many of them via our high-speed Wi-Fi offerings. Our solutions create healthier air travel, more fuel-efficient and better-maintained aircraft, more direct and on-time flight arrivals, safer skies and airports, and more comfortable flights, along with several innovations and services that reflect exciting and emerging new transportation methods such as autonomous and supersonic flight. Revenues in 2023 for Honeywell Aerospace Technology were $14B and there are approximately 21,000 employees globally.
